Precision glass moulding can be used to produce a large variety of optical form elements such as spheres, aspheres, free-form elements and array-structures. Concerning the curvature of the lens elements, the following statements can be drawn: Acceptable lens shapes are most bi-convex, plano-convex and mild meniscus shapes. WebNov 11, 2024 · Polystyrene Injection Molding. Polystyrene (PS) is a commodity thermoplastic with an amorphous structure. It has excellent resistance to gamma rays and, therefore, supports sterilization by radiation. Polystyrene plastics can be either transparent or opaque, and unmodified polystyrene is clear, rigid, brittle and moderately strong. WebMar 19, 2003 · Essilor went into the casting business on a limited basis in 2000 and recently launched its proprietary DRx (for direct-to-prescription) in-lab casting technology. DRx cast molds each lens in minutes. DRx is available in Essilors Varilux Panamic and Varilux Comfort progressive lenses on finished jobs.
